A common colloquial way of saying definitely or certainly. The majesty of royalty, you see. "Majesty" is greatness or great dignity and grace, and "royalty" refers to the families of kings and queens. It might be that this dude here is English Bob. "Dude" has recently become a popular colloquial word for guy. He’s waiting for some crazy cowboy to touch his pistol so that he can shoot him down. "To shoot down" a person is to shoot and perhaps kill them. Let’s shoot some pheasant. Let’s say one dollar a pheasant. A type of large bird. No doubt your aim was affected by your grief over the injury to your President. A person’s "aim" is the ability to shoot accurately or straight. "Grief" is the great sadness that follows a tragedy, such as the death of a child. It’s the climate….and the infernal distances that induces people to shoot persons in high places. "Infernal" is a way of saying hellish or horrible. "To induce" a person to do something is to convince or persuade them. It’s a savage country; That’s the second one they shot in 20 years. "Savage" means uncivilized, wild or cruel. This refers to the fact Presidents Lincoln (1861) and Garfield (1881) were both shot to death. It’s uncivilized shooting persons of substance. This is English Bob’s way of referring to important people. The local ordinance obliges you to surrender all sidearms to the proper authorities during your visit. An "ordinance" is a law, often passed by a city or town. "To oblige" a person to do something is to require or force them to do it. "Sidearms" are guns, and the "proper authorities" are the police, or here, sheriff. Neither my companion or I carry firearms on our person. Another word for guns. We rely on the good will of our fellow man and the forbearance of reptiles. "Good will" is kindness. "Forbearance" is an educated word for restraint or self-control. "Reptiles" are animals like snakes, lizards, etc. Unarmed, my ass. If a person is "unarmed," they are not carrying any guns or other weapons. "My ass" is a funny way of expressing disbelief or cynicism. You boys clean my Remington? :: Clean and loaded. Remington is a famous brand of gun. If a gun is "loaded," it has bullets in it and is ready to shoot. Where’s Little Bill, for Christ’s sake. A common way of expressing anger or frustration. He don’t have a straight angle on that whole god damn porch, or on the whole house, for that matter. A "straight angle" refers to space that is formed when two perpendicular lines cross (as in "+").
